Suzlon bags 100.8 MW wind order from Sunsure Energy 

Suzlon has secured an engineering, procurement, and construction wind power order of 100.8 MW from Sunsure Energy. As part of the agreement, Suzlon will supply 48 S120 wind turbine generators, each with a rated capacity of 2.1 MW, mounted on hybrid lattice towers. 

Suzlon will be responsible for supplying the turbines, installing the equipment, and handling the entire project execution, including erection and commissioning. The project will be implemented in the Jath region of Maharashtra. Additionally, the project marks Sunsure’s first project in the wind energy segment. 

Furthermore, Suzlon will also provide comprehensive operations and maintenance services once the project is commissioned. This project is intended to support Sunsure Energy’s strategy to provide round-the-clock renewable power to its customers in Maharashtra.
